Connector icon indicating copy to clipboard operation
Connector copied to clipboard

Коннектор: удобный HTTP-клиент для 1С:Предприятие 8

Results 50 Connector issues
Sort by recently updated
recently updated
newest added

Пример https://iss.moex.com/iss/securities/RU000A100WA8.json?iss.meta=off&iss.only=description&iss.json=extended Валимся с ошибкой ``` Ошибка при вызове метода контекста (Свойство) {ОбщийМодуль.КоннекторHTTP.Модуль(3396)}:ПараметрНайден = Приемник.Свойство(ЭлементИсточника.Ключ); {ОбщийМодуль.КоннекторHTTP.Модуль(3367)}:Дополнить(ГлавныйИсточник, ДополнительныйИсточник); {ОбщийМодуль.КоннекторHTTP.Модуль(1788)}:ОбъединенныеПараметрыЗапроса = Объединить(Скопировать(ПараметрыЗапроса), СтруктураURL.ПараметрыЗапроса); {ОбщийМодуль.КоннекторHTTP.Модуль(1778)}:ПодготовленныйURL = ПодготовленныйURL + СобратьАдресРесурса(СтруктураURL, ПараметрыЗапроса); {ОбщийМодуль.КоннекторHTTP.Модуль(1228)}:ПодготовленныйЗапрос.Вставить("URL", ПодготовитьURL(URL, ПараметрыЗапроса));...

Пытаюсь передать заголовок "Accept". настройкиПодключения_FacadeNet.НовыеПараметры.Заголовки.Вставить("Accept", "application/octet-stream") ответHTTP = FacadeCore_HTTPApi.Post(Url, , настройкиПодключения_FacadeNet.НовыеПараметры, FacadeCore_НастройкиПовтИсп.ТекущаяСессия()); Вместо этого передается */* После изучения исходников было выяснено, что это значение устанавливается функцией СоздатьСессию() И в функции...

Content-Length - размер в байтах тела запроса у добавил костыль, но как временное решение ``` Если ЗначениеЗаполнено(Файлы) Тогда ContentType = ЗакодироватьФайлы(HTTPЗапрос, Файлы, Данные); ПодготовленныйЗапрос.Заголовки.Вставить("Content-Length", XMLСтрока(HTTPЗапрос.ПолучитьТелоКакДвоичныеДанные().Размер())); ``` по хорошему надо переработать...

Функция Post и подобные модифицирует свой входной параметр ДополнительныеПараметры, используя его для своих внутренних целей, и эти изменения протекают в код, вызывающий эту функцию. Это мешает использовать значение ДополнительныеПараметры повторно....

В функции КодироватьПараметрыЗапроса происходит неявное приведение к типу Строка значения параметра в вызове КодироватьСтроку [ЗначениеПараметра = КодироватьСтроку(Значение, СпособКодированияСтроки.КодировкаURL);](https://github.com/vbondarevsky/Connector/blob/a412f844ca6464e607f567bd0e8ba50afaf51d58/src/ru/CommonModules/%D0%9A%D0%BE%D0%BD%D0%BD%D0%B5%D0%BA%D1%82%D0%BE%D1%80HTTP/Ext/Module.bsl#L1513) 1. Тип Булево: Истина, Ложь -> "Да", "Нет" (в кодировке URL) вместо...

Функция `Скопировать()` всегда возвращает соответствие вместо структуры при работе в режиме мобильного приложения, что вызывает падение далее. Пример: ```bsl Аутентификация = КоннекторHTTP.НоваяАутентификацияBasic("Логин", "Пароль"); ДополнительныеПараметры = Новый Структура; ДополнительныеПараметры.Вставить("Аутентификация", Аутентификация); ДополнительныеПараметры.Вставить("ПараметрыПреобразованияJSON",...